BCW (Blind-Spot Collision
Warning) (If equipped)
Operating conditions
The indicator on the switch will illumi-
nate when the BCW (Blind-Spot
Collision Warning) system switch is
pressed with the ignition switch ON.
If the vehicle speed exceeds 30 km/h
(18.6 mph), the system will activate.
If you press the switch again, the
switch indicator and system will be
turned off.
If the ignition switch is turned OFF
and ON the system returns to the
previous state.
When the system is not used turn the
system off by pressing the switch.
When the system is turned on the
warning light will illuminate for 3 sec-
onds on the outside rearview mirror.
The driver can activate the system
by placing the ignition switch to the
ON position and by selecting "User
Settings Driver assistance
Blind-spot safety"
- The BCW turns on and gets
ready to be activated when
'Warning only' is selected. Then,
if a vehicle approaches the dri-
ver's blind spot area a warning
sounds.
- The system is deactivated and
the indicator on the BCW button
is extinguished when 'Off‘ is
selected.
If you press BCW button whilst
'Warning only' is selected the indi-
cator on the button extinguishes
and the system deactivates.
If you press BCW button whilst the
system is cancelled the indicator
on the button illuminates and the
system activates. In this case, the
system returns to the state before
the engine turned off.
